Understanding HDD Drill Rods

Before delving into the transportation process, it's essential to understand what HDD drill rods are and their significance in the drilling industry. HDD drill rods are specialized pipes used in horizontal directional drilling, a trenchless method of installing underground utilities. These rods are typically made of high-strength steel and come in various sizes and specifications, such as 73mm Drilling Rod and 83mm Drilling Rod. They need to withstand high torque, pressure, and bending forces during the drilling process.

Pre - transport Preparations

  1. Inspection: Thoroughly inspect the drill rods before transportation. Check for any signs of damage, such as cracks, dents, or corrosion. Any damaged rods should be repaired or removed from the shipment to prevent further issues during transit.
  2. Cleaning: Clean the drill rods to remove any dirt, debris, or drilling fluids. This not only helps in maintaining the integrity of the rods but also prevents contamination during transportation.
  3. Marking and Identification: Mark each drill rod with a unique identifier, such as a serial number or barcode. This makes it easier to track and manage the rods during transportation and at the destination.

Selecting the Right Transport Method

  1. Trucking: Trucking is one of the most common methods of transporting HDD drill rods. When choosing a truck, consider its load - carrying capacity, body length, and the availability of securement options. Flatbed trucks are often preferred as they provide easy loading and unloading access. Ensure that the truck is in good mechanical condition and that the driver is experienced in transporting heavy and long loads.
  2. Rail Transport: For long - distance transportation, rail transport can be a cost - effective option. Railcars can carry a large number of drill rods, but they require proper loading and securing. Specialized railcar designs may be needed to accommodate the long and cylindrical shape of the drill rods.
  3. Shipping Containers: If the drill rods need to be transported overseas, shipping containers are a viable option. Select the appropriate container size based on the quantity and length of the drill rods. Ensure that the interior of the container is clean and dry and that the rods are properly secured inside.

Loading the Drill Rods

  1. Proper Equipment: Use appropriate lifting equipment, such as cranes or forklifts, to load the drill rods onto the transport vehicle. Make sure the equipment is rated for the weight and size of the rods.
  2. Stacking: When stacking the drill rods, stack them in an orderly manner to prevent shifting during transit. Use spacers or dunnage between the layers to protect the rods from damage. The maximum height of the stack should be limited to ensure stability.
  3. Securement: Secure the drill rods firmly to the transport vehicle using straps, chains, or other appropriate securement devices. Pay special attention to the ends of the rods to prevent them from moving forward or backward.

Transportation Precautions

  1. Route Planning: Plan the transportation route carefully. Consider the weight and dimensions of the load and check for any road restrictions, such as low bridges or weight limits. Avoid routes with rough roads or sharp turns that could cause excessive vibration or stress on the drill rods.
  2. Speed and Driving Style: The driver should maintain a moderate speed and avoid sudden stops, starts, or turns. Excessive speed and aggressive driving can increase the risk of damage to the drill rods due to vibration and impact.
  3. Weather Considerations: Extreme weather conditions, such as heavy rain, snow, or high winds, can affect the safety of the transportation. If possible, schedule the transportation during favorable weather conditions. If adverse weather is unavoidable, take extra precautions to protect the drill rods from moisture and damage.

Unloading at the Destination

  1. Safe Unloading: Use the same proper lifting equipment as in the loading process to unload the drill rods at the destination. Ensure that the unloading area is clear of any obstacles and that the ground is stable.
  2. Re - inspection: After unloading, conduct a re - inspection of the drill rods to check for any damage that may have occurred during transportation. If any damage is found, report it immediately and take appropriate action.

Importance of Quality Packaging

In addition to the above steps, quality packaging can provide an extra layer of protection for the drill rods. Specialized packaging materials, such as plastic caps at the ends of the rods, can prevent debris from entering the rods or protect the threads. Wrapping the rods with protective films can also reduce the risk of surface scratches and corrosion.
